Join BA Blacktop Ltd. as a Production Manager in our Fraser Valley-based Industry Department.

Job Purpose

The Production Manager is a key leadership position created to support both major plant replacement projects and the long-term operational leadership of the industry department.

The role combines full accountability for leading major plant replacement projects with direct oversight of ongoing operations, including production efficiency, team leadership, and continuous improvement. The Production Manager ensures that capital projects are delivered on schedule and within budget while also maintaining high standards of safety, quality, and performance across daily operations.

This role is critical for succession planning, ensuring that operational leadership is strengthened and prepared for future growth.

Key Tasks And Responsibilities

Project Management (Plant Replacement Projects)

  • Ensure compliance with safety, environmental, and regulatory requirements thro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Serve as Project Manager for the plant replacement, ensuring successful execution.
  • Act as the single point of accountability for the project’s progress, aligning with corporate expectations.
  • Coordinate with engineering, construction teams, vendors, and contractors to track progress and resolve issues.
  • Manage budgets, schedules, and risk mitigation plans to prevent delays and cost overruns.
  • Provide regular updates and reporting to senior leadership on project status and critical risks.

Operational Leadership & Continuous Improvement

  • Ensure compliance with Safe Work Plans, Environmental Management Plans, and Emergency Response Plans.
  • Oversee and improve the daily operations of the asphalt plants, focusing on efficiency, quality, and safety.
  • Lead and mentor the Foremen and Superintendents to build a strong, accountable team.
  • Manage plant production schedules, material planning, and plant logistics to ensure alignment with construction demand.
  • Implement process improvements to increase productivity and reduce waste.
  • Monitor and address quality control plans and testing procedures to ensure products meet required specifications.
  • Act as liaison between plant operations and construction, ensuring production meets project requirements.
  • Support budget development and cost control initiatives to improve operational efficiency.
